Advantages of Upgrading to Alloy Car Rims
Car rims are an essential component of any vehicle, not only serving a functional purpose but also playing a significant role in the overall aesthetics of the car. When it comes to upgrading your car rims, alloy rims are a popular choice among car enthusiasts for several reasons. In this article, we will explore the advantages of upgrading to alloy car rims and why they are a worthwhile investment for your vehicle.
One of the primary advantages of alloy car rims is their lightweight construction. Unlike traditional steel rims, alloy rims are made from a combination of aluminum and other metals, making them significantly lighter. This reduced weight can have a positive impact on your vehicle’s performance, as lighter rims can improve acceleration, braking, and overall handling. Additionally, the lighter weight of alloy rims can also lead to better fuel efficiency, as the engine does not have to work as hard to move the vehicle.
In addition to their lightweight construction, alloy rims are also known for their durability and strength. The combination of aluminum and other metals used in alloy rims creates a strong and resilient material that can withstand the rigors of daily driving. This durability means that alloy rims are less likely to bend, crack, or warp under normal driving conditions, making them a long-lasting investment for your vehicle.
Another advantage of upgrading to alloy car rims is their aesthetic appeal. Alloy rims are available in a wide range of styles, finishes, and designs, allowing you to customize the look of your vehicle to suit your personal taste. Whether you prefer a sleek and modern look or a more classic and timeless design, there is an alloy rim option to suit every preference. Additionally, alloy rims can be easily painted or powder-coated to match your vehicle’s color scheme, further enhancing the overall appearance of your car.
Furthermore, alloy rims are also known for their heat dissipation properties. The aluminum construction of alloy rims allows for better heat conduction, which can help to dissipate heat more effectively from the brakes and tires. This improved heat dissipation can help to prevent overheating and brake fade, leading to better overall performance and safety on the road.

The Process of Automobile Casting for High-Quality Wheels
Car rims are an essential component of any vehicle, not only serving a functional purpose but also adding to the overall aesthetic appeal of the car. When it comes to manufacturing high-quality car rims, automobile casting is a process that is widely used in the industry. This process involves pouring molten metal into a mold to create the desired shape of the wheel. In this article, we will explore the process of automobile casting for high-quality wheels and the benefits it offers.
The first step in the automobile casting process is to create a mold that will be used to shape the wheel. This mold is typically made from a material such as sand or metal and is designed to withstand the high temperatures and pressures involved in the casting process. Once the mold is ready, the next step is to heat the metal to its melting point and pour it into the mold. This molten metal will then take on the shape of the mold as it cools and solidifies.
One of the key benefits of automobile casting for car rims is the ability to create complex and intricate designs that would be difficult or impossible to achieve using other manufacturing methods. This allows for a greater level of customization and personalization, giving car owners the opportunity to choose wheels that reflect their individual style and preferences. Additionally, automobile casting allows for the production of wheels that are lightweight yet strong, providing improved performance and handling for the vehicle.
Another advantage of automobile casting is the cost-effectiveness of the process. While the initial setup costs for creating the molds and equipment may be high, the ability to produce large quantities of wheels quickly and efficiently helps to offset these expenses. This makes automobile casting a viable option for manufacturers looking to produce high-quality wheels in a cost-effective manner.
In addition to the cost savings, automobile casting also offers environmental benefits. The process produces minimal waste and can be done using recyclable materials, making it a more sustainable option compared to other manufacturing methods. This aligns with the growing trend towards eco-friendly practices in the automotive industry and helps to reduce the overall carbon footprint of wheel production.
Furthermore, automobile casting allows for greater consistency and precision in the production of car rims. The molds used in the casting process can be designed to exact specifications, ensuring that each wheel is identical in size, shape, and quality. This level of precision is crucial in ensuring the safety and performance of the wheels, as even minor variations can impact the overall functionality of the vehicle.

Top Trends in Car Rim Designs for 2021
Car rims are an essential component of any vehicle, not only serving a functional purpose but also playing a significant role in the overall aesthetic appeal of the car. As we move into 2021, car rim designs continue to evolve, with manufacturers pushing the boundaries of creativity and innovation to meet the demands of consumers looking for unique and stylish options to enhance their vehicles.
One of the top trends in car rim designs for 2021 is the use of automobile casting wheels. Casting is a manufacturing process that involves pouring molten metal into a mold to create a specific shape. This method allows for intricate designs and details to be incorporated into the rims, resulting in visually stunning and highly customizable options for car enthusiasts.
Automobile casting wheels offer a wide range of design possibilities, from sleek and modern styles to more intricate and ornate patterns. Manufacturers are experimenting with different finishes, such as matte black, chrome, and even custom paint colors, to create rims that stand out on the road. These wheels are not only visually appealing but also durable and long-lasting, making them a popular choice among car owners looking for both style and performance.
In addition to casting wheels, another trend in car rim designs for 2021 is the use of unique materials. While traditional rims are typically made of aluminum or steel, manufacturers are now exploring alternative materials such as carbon fiber, titanium, and even wood to create rims that are lightweight, strong, and visually striking. These materials offer a high level of customization and allow for the creation of rims that are truly one-of-a-kind.

Another popular trend in car rim designs for 2021 is the use of multi-piece rims. These rims are made up of multiple components that are bolted together, allowing for greater flexibility in design and customization. Car owners can mix and match different finishes, colors, and materials to create a truly unique look for their vehicle. Multi-piece rims also offer the added benefit of easy repair and maintenance, as individual components can be replaced if damaged.
As car rim designs continue to evolve, manufacturers are also focusing on incorporating advanced technology into their products. Many rims now come equipped with features such as built-in sensors for tire pressure monitoring, integrated LED lighting, and even self-healing coatings to protect against scratches and damage. These technological advancements not only enhance the functionality of the rims but also add a futuristic and high-tech element to the overall design.
